John Simons is the Enterprise Editor at International Business Times. Prior to IBT, he was technology and media editor at The Associated Press. In previous incarnations, John has been an editorial director at Black Enterprise, a staff writer at Fortune magazine, an economic policy reporter at the Wall Street Journal, and a senior editor at U.S. News & World Report. He was also a Markle Fellow at the New America Foundation, where he focused on technology policy and economic opportunity in the digital age. He has discussed his work on The PBS News Hour, CNN, The Fox Network, MSNBC, National Public Radio, and CNBC, where he is a regular contributor. John lives in Montclair, New Jersey, where he enjoys hiking with his wife and daughter, keeping up with the English Premier League, and trying his hand at various home improvement projects.
